Ìlorin Ni

Ìlorin Ni
The age long emirate dynasty
Founded on a land sparse and arid
By Ojo, a renowned blacksmith
With few houses and lovely people

Ìlorin Ni
Emirate is our kinsghip title
Al Qur'an is our foremost treasury 
Studying and committing it to memory
And Tirahs with different life meanings

Ìlorin Ni
A place not too close to the desert
But the sun scotch and hit us hard
A place not too close to the water beds
But when it rains, it brings blessings forth

Ìlorin Ni
Our ancient houses are made of mud
From little water mixed with mother earth
As defence against intruders' gun shots
During inter racial conflicts and several wars

Ìlorin Ni
Where everyone lives as one family
We are not just nice, but very lovely
With strangers finding us very accommodating
Our women are nice and our foods are treaty

Ìlorin Ni
Our last kobo can be spent on party 
Every weekend, someone must get married
This, we value and keep its sweet memory
As one of the few treasures which we cherish

Ìlorin Ni
A land full of diverse knowledge 
Home of renowned sheiks and several professors
With children well versed in arabia
And adults who are graduates and hard workers

- Acetyl (February, 2020)
An Indigene of the great Emirate dynasty.
